List of all items
Structs
- TestCoin
- TestDeposit
- WasmMockQuerier
- authz::response::Grant
- authz::response::GrantAuthorization
- authz::response::GranteeGrantsResponse
- authz::response::GranterGrantsResponse
- authz::response::GrantsResponse
- authz::response::PageResponse
- exchange::derivative::DerivativeLimitOrder
- exchange::derivative::DerivativeMarketOrder
- exchange::derivative::DerivativeOrder
- exchange::derivative::DerivativePosition
- exchange::derivative::EffectivePosition
- exchange::derivative::Position
- exchange::derivative::ShortDerivativeOrder
- exchange::derivative::TrimmedDerivativeLimitOrder
- exchange::derivative_market::DerivativeMarket
- exchange::derivative_market::FullDerivativeMarket
- exchange::derivative_market::FullDerivativeMarketPerpetualInfo
- exchange::derivative_market::PerpetualMarketFunding
- exchange::derivative_market::PerpetualMarketInfo
- exchange::derivative_market::PerpetualMarketState
- exchange::order::OrderData
- exchange::order::OrderInfo
- exchange::order::ShortOrderData
- exchange::order::ShortOrderInfo
- exchange::privileged_action::FPDecimalCoin
- exchange::privileged_action::PositionTransferAction
- exchange::privileged_action::PrivilegedAction
- exchange::privileged_action::SyntheticTrade
- exchange::privileged_action::SyntheticTradeAction
- exchange::response::DerivativeMarketResponse
- exchange::response::ExchangeParamsResponse
- exchange::response::MarketMidPriceAndTOBResponse
- exchange::response::MarketVolatilityResponse
- exchange::response::OracleVolatilityResponse
- exchange::response::PerpetualMarketFundingResponse
- exchange::response::PerpetualMarketInfoResponse
- exchange::response::QueryAggregateMarketVolumeResponse
- exchange::response::QueryAggregateVolumeResponse
- exchange::response::QueryDenomDecimalResponse
- exchange::response::QueryDenomDecimalsResponse
- exchange::response::QueryMarketAtomicExecutionFeeMultiplierResponse
- exchange::response::QueryOrderbookResponse
- exchange::response::SpotMarketResponse
- exchange::response::StakedAmountResponse
- exchange::response::SubaccountDepositResponse
- exchange::response::SubaccountEffectivePositionInMarketResponse
- exchange::response::SubaccountPositionInMarketResponse
- exchange::response::TraderDerivativeOrdersResponse
- exchange::response::TraderSpotOrdersResponse
- exchange::spot::MsgCreateSpotMarketOrderResponse
- exchange::spot::ShortOrderInfo
- exchange::spot::ShortSpotOrder
- exchange::spot::SpotLimitOrder
- exchange::spot::SpotMarketOrder
- exchange::spot::SpotMarketOrderResults
- exchange::spot::SpotOrder
- exchange::spot::TrimmedSpotLimitOrder
- exchange::spot_market::SpotMarket
- exchange::types::DenomDecimals
- exchange::types::Deposit
- exchange::types::Hash
- exchange::types::MarketId
- exchange::types::MarketVolume
- exchange::types::Params
- exchange::types::PriceLevel
- exchange::types::ShortSubaccountId
- exchange::types::SubaccountId
- exchange::types::VolumeByType
- msg::InjectiveMsgWrapper
- oracle::response::OraclePriceResponse
- oracle::response::PythPriceResponse
- oracle::types::OracleHistoryOptions
- oracle::types::OracleInfo
- oracle::types::OracleVolatilityResponse
- oracle::types::PriceAttestation
- oracle::types::PricePairState
- oracle::types::PriceState
- oracle::types::PythPriceState
- oracle::types::ScalingOptions
- oracle::volatility::MetadataStatistics
- oracle::volatility::PriceRecord
- oracle::volatility::TradeHistoryOptions
- oracle::volatility::TradeRecord
- querier::InjectiveQuerier
- query::InjectiveQueryWrapper
- tokenfactory::response::TokenFactoryCreateDenomFeeResponse
- tokenfactory::response::TokenFactoryDenomSupplyResponse
- wasmx::response::QueryContractRegistrationInfoResponse
- wasmx::types::RegisteredContract
Enums
- exchange::cancel::CancellationStrategy
- exchange::market::MarketStatus
- exchange::order::OrderSide
- exchange::order::OrderType
- exchange::types::AtomicMarketOrderAccessLevel
- exchange::types::MarketType
- msg::InjectiveMsg
- oracle::types::OracleQuery
- oracle::types::OracleType
- oracle::types::PythStatus
- query::InjectiveQuery
- route::InjectiveRoute
- wasmx::types::FundingMode
Traits
- HandlesAccountVolumeQuery
- HandlesBankAllBalancesQuery
- HandlesBankBalanceQuery
- HandlesBankQuery
- HandlesByAddressQuery
- HandlesCodeInfo
- HandlesContractInfo
- HandlesDenomDecimalQuery
- HandlesDenomDecimalsQuery
- HandlesDenomSupplyQuery
- HandlesDerivativePriceLevelsQuery
- HandlesExchangeParamsQuery
- HandlesFeeQuery
- HandlesMarketAndSubaccountQuery
- HandlesMarketIdQuery
- HandlesMarketVolatilityQuery
- HandlesMarketVolumeQuery
- HandlesOraclePriceQuery
- HandlesOracleVolatilityQuery
- HandlesPriceLevelsQuery
- HandlesPythPriceQuery
- HandlesRawQuery
- HandlesSmartQuery
- HandlesStakedAmountQuery
- HandlesSubaccountAndDenomQuery
- HandlesSubaccountIdQuery
- HandlesTraderDerivativeOrdersToCancelUpToAmountQuery
- HandlesTraderSpotOrdersToCancelUpToAmountQuery
- OwnedDepsExt
- exchange::market::GenericMarket
- exchange::order::GenericOrder
- exchange::order::GenericTrimmedOrder
Functions
- create_atomic_order_fee_multiplier_handler
- create_bank_supply_handler
- create_code_id_handler
- create_contract_info_handler
- create_denom_creation_fee_handler
- create_denom_supply_handler
- create_derivative_market_handler
- create_derivative_orders_up_to_amount_handler
- create_market_mid_price_and_tob_handler
- create_mock_spot_market
- create_oracle_query_handler
- create_oracle_volatility_handler
- create_orderbook_response_handler
- create_raw_query_handler
- create_registered_contract_info_query_handler
- create_simple_all_balances_bank_query_handler
- create_simple_balance_bank_query_handler
- create_smart_query_handler
- create_spot_market_handler
- create_spot_multi_market_handler
- create_spot_orders_up_to_amount_handler
- create_subaccount_deposit_complex_handler
- create_subaccount_deposit_err_returning_handler
- create_subaccount_deposit_handler
- create_subaccount_effective_position_in_market_handler
- create_subaccount_position_in_market_handler
- create_trader_derivative_orders_handler
- create_trader_spot_orders_handler
- exchange::derivative::derivative_order_to_short
- exchange::order::order_data_to_short
- exchange::privileged_action::coins_to_string
- exchange::spot::spot_order_to_short
- exchange::spot_market::calculate_spot_market_id
- exchange::subaccount::addr_to_bech32
- exchange::subaccount::bech32_to_hex
- exchange::subaccount::checked_address_to_subaccount_id
- exchange::subaccount::get_default_subaccount_id_for_checked_address
- exchange::subaccount::is_default_subaccount
- exchange::subaccount::subaccount_id_to_ethereum_address
- exchange::subaccount::subaccount_id_to_injective_address
- exchange::subaccount::subaccount_id_to_unchecked_injective_address
- handlers::create_atomic_order_fee_multiplier_handler
- handlers::create_bank_supply_handler
- handlers::create_code_id_handler
- handlers::create_contract_info_handler
- handlers::create_denom_creation_fee_handler
- handlers::create_denom_supply_handler
- handlers::create_derivative_market_handler
- handlers::create_derivative_orders_up_to_amount_handler
- handlers::create_market_mid_price_and_tob_handler
- handlers::create_oracle_query_handler
- handlers::create_oracle_volatility_handler
- handlers::create_orderbook_response_handler
- handlers::create_raw_query_handler
- handlers::create_registered_contract_info_query_handler
- handlers::create_simple_all_balances_bank_query_handler
- handlers::create_simple_balance_bank_query_handler
- handlers::create_smart_query_handler
- handlers::create_spot_market_handler
- handlers::create_spot_multi_market_handler
- handlers::create_spot_orders_up_to_amount_handler
- handlers::create_subaccount_deposit_complex_handler
- handlers::create_subaccount_deposit_err_returning_handler
- handlers::create_subaccount_deposit_handler
- handlers::create_subaccount_effective_position_in_market_handler
- handlers::create_subaccount_position_in_market_handler
- handlers::create_trader_derivative_orders_handler
- handlers::create_trader_spot_orders_handler
- inj_mock_deps
- inj_mock_env
- mock_dependencies
- msg::cancel_derivative_order_msg
- msg::cancel_spot_order_msg
- msg::create_activate_contract_msg
- msg::create_batch_update_orders_msg
- msg::create_burn_tokens_msg
- msg::create_deactivate_contract_msg
- msg::create_deposit_msg
- msg::create_derivative_market_order_msg
- msg::create_external_transfer_msg
- msg::create_increase_position_margin_msg
- msg::create_liquidate_position_msg
- msg::create_mint_tokens_msg
- msg::create_new_denom_msg
- msg::create_privileged_execute_contract_msg
- msg::create_relay_pyth_prices_msg
- msg::create_rewards_opt_out_msg
- msg::create_set_token_metadata_msg
- msg::create_spot_market_order_msg
- msg::create_subaccount_transfer_msg
- msg::create_update_contract_msg
- msg::create_withdraw_msg
- test_market_ids
Type Aliases
- DerivativeUpToAmountConsumingFunction
- SpotUpToAmountConsumingFunction
- handlers::DerivativeUpToAmountConsumingFunction
- handlers::SpotUpToAmountConsumingFunction